It's bad for me cause I have a AEM V2 intake sitting very close by sucking in all that hot air, which causes lower HP. I also overtorqued the top two bolts(peice of **** torque wrench) and snapped them and I beleive some hot air is ecaping do to that as well. Something I need to fix as soon as I get back. Other than the heat issue it seems to be fine. I installed the header and exhaust at the same time, plus I'm running no cat. It's been so long(6 or 7 mo), but I'm pretty sure there was a gain. I ran 15.7 with I/H/E my weight reduction and the power steering pulley belt off on stock 14's. with around 22psi. Bone stock I ran 17.0. So I'd say I shaved .3 due to improved driving skills/60ft and a full second from the combination of those mods.
If you want looks get the chrome, cause the nickel turns into this rainbowish/dull finnish.

Get the caspers O2 sim. Might be pricey at $80 to some people, but it is so easy a monkey could do it. Plug n Play saves time,looks clean and you could always go back to stock if needed, no splicing.
